The Rock & Roll Hall of Fame has revealed the names of its 2025 inductees bringing a blend of iconic rock acts and trailblazing artists into the spotlight. The announcement was made during a special episode of the reality show American Idol on April 27, 2025. Cyndi Lauper leads the list as the solo woman artist in the Performer Category. Joining the list are acts like Bad Company Soundgarden , and The White Stripes According to a USA Today report, this year's selection leaned towards a more traditional rock lineup. Notably, the lineup included hip-hop pioneers Outkast. All these inducted performers have previously achieved top-five albums on the Billboard 200 chart.The report stated that the full induction ceremony will air live on November 8, 2025. It will be hosted at the Peacock Theatre in Los Angeles and will be streamed on Disney+. A special broadcast will be available on ABC on a later date. It will also be available on Hulu to stream later.In addition to the performer inductees, several influential musicians will be presented with special honours. Salt-N-Pepa and Warren Zevon will be receiving the Musical Influence Award for their impact on the music industry.Carol Kaye, Nicky Hopkins, and Thom Bell will be honoured with the Musical Excellence Award for their contributions to the music industry. Lastly, Lenny Waronker will receive the prestigious Ahmet Ertegun Award, which is given to persons who have made remarkable contributions behind the scenes in the music world.Reportedly, Carol Kaye, at 90, is the oldest inductee of the Rock & Roll Hall of Fame 2025. Meanwhile, some recipients like Chris Cornell of Soundgarden, Warren Zevon, Nicky Hopkins, and Thom Bell have been inducted posthumously.The Rock & Roll Hall of Fame 2025, as per the Billboard report, was notably won by Phish. The band is known for its powerhouse live performances. However, in spite of winning the fan votes and generating considerable buzz, Phish didn't make it into the induction class.Other acts that did not make it to the induction are Oasis and Mariah Carey. Additionally, brother acts like Oasis' Liam and Noel Gallagher and The Black Crowes' Chris and Rich Robinson also did not make it.At the same time, Maná lost an opportunity to become the first rock en español group to be inducted, and Joy Division/New Order failed to join the select group of related acts that entered together, such as Parliament/Funkadelic and The Small Faces/Faces.The Rock & Roll Hall of Fame 2025 will take place live at the Peacock Theatre in Los Angeles on 8 November 2025. It will be streamed on Disney+ and then be broadcast on ABC and Hulu.No, gaining the fan vote does not mean induction. This year, Phish received the fan vote but were not inducted.

MLB All-Star Game voting: How does it work and when will final team be announced?
The 2025 MLB All-Star Game, set for July 15 at Truist Park in Atlanta, hosted by the Atlanta Braves, features a fan voting process to select starting players, with pitchers and reserves chosen by players and the Commissioner's Office. Fans can vote for eight starting position players and a designated hitter in each league, with the first round of voting running from June 4 to June 26. The top vote-getter in each league becomes a starter automatically and the two players at the infield positions and six outfielders advance to the second phase of voting. The voting runs from June 30 to July 2, with winners getting starting spots. If the top vote-getter is an outfielder, then four players advance to fill the final two spots. The MLB All-Star Game voting determines the starting position players (excluding pitchers) for the American League (AL) and National League (NL) teams, each comprising 34 players (20 position players, 14 pitchers). The process is split into two phases: How it Works: Fans vote for AL and NL starters at each position (one player per infield position, three outfielders, one designated hitter). Voting opened on June 4 at noon ET and runs through June 26 at noon ET. Fans can vote up to five times every 24 hours via all 30 MLB club sites, the MLB App, or the MLB Ballpark App. An additional daily vote is available through the Konami eBaseball™: MLB Pro Spirit mobile app. Fans can write in one player per position not listed on the ballot, but only once per ballot. The top vote-getter in each league automatically secures a starting spot. The top two vote-getters at each position (top six for outfielders) advance to Phase 2, with results revealed on June 26 at 6 PM ET on MLB Network. If an outfielder leads the league, only the next four outfielders advance. How it works: Fans vote among the Phase 1 finalists to select the remaining starters (one per position, three outfielders). Voting runs from June 30 at noon ET to July 2 at noon ET, with fans limited to one vote per 24 hours on MLB platforms. Winners are announced on July 2 at 7 PM ET on ESPN, forming the starting lineups (eight position players plus a DH per league). The remaining 23 players per team (14 pitchers, 9 reserves) are selected via player ballots (17 AL, 16 NL players) and Commissioner's Office choices (6 AL, 8 NL). Starting pitchers and DHs (for NL) are determined solely by player ballots and the Commissioner's Office. If a voted starter cannot play, the player with the next-most fan votes from Phase 2 replaces them. The Commissioner's Office fills the reserve spot. Phase 1 finalists: Top two vote-getters per position (top six outfielders) announced on June 26, 2025, at 6 PM ET on MLB Network. Starting lineups: Phase 2 winners, comprising the eight starting position players and DH for each league, will be announced on July 2, 2025, at 7 PM ET on ESPN. Full rosters: Complete 34-player rosters, including pitchers and reserves, announced on July 6, 2025, at 5 PM ET. Managers: Dave Roberts (Los Angeles Dodgers, NL) and Aaron Boone (New York Yankees, AL) will manage the 2025 All-Star teams, following their 2024 pennant wins. The 95th MLB All-Star Game airs on FOX at 8 PM ET on July 15, 2025, with a $640,000 bonus pool split among the winning team's 34 players ($20,000 each).
